CVE-2026-82439: CWE-770 Allocation of resources without limits or throttling in Apache Software Foundation Apache Storm DRPC

Description

Apache Storm DRPC versions 3.0.0 up to but not including 3.1.0 have a resource allocation vulnerability where the DRPC server retains a map entry for each unique function name received from clients without ever removing it. Since function names are client-controlled and unrestricted, an attacker can cause the server to exhaust its heap memory by sending many distinct function names. By default, no authorization is required to access the DRPC endpoint, increasing exposure. This issue is fixed in version 3.1.0, which removes function queues when they are empty.

Technical Analysis

The Apache Storm DRPC server maintains a map from function names to request queues, creating entries for each new function name seen. These entries are never removed, even after requests are processed and queues drained, causing permanent retention of state. Because function names are client-controlled and unrestricted, an attacker can send numerous distinct names to cause unbounded growth of retained entries, leading to heap exhaustion. The default configuration does not require credentials to access the DRPC endpoint, increasing the risk. The vulnerability is addressed in Apache Storm version 3.1.0, which removes function queues once they are empty.

Potential Impact

An attacker can cause a denial of service by exhausting the DRPC server's heap memory through sending many distinct function names, leading to resource exhaustion and potential service disruption. The lack of default authorization on the DRPC endpoint increases the attack surface, allowing unauthenticated attackers to exploit this vulnerability.

Mitigation Recommendations

Upgrade Apache Storm DRPC to version 3.1.0 or later, where the function queues are removed once empty, preventing unbounded resource retention. For users unable to upgrade immediately, configure the 'drpc.authorizer' setting to restrict access to trusted principals only, and ensure DRPC ports are not accessible from untrusted networks.
